CORVALLIS, Ore. – The Cascade Collegiate Conference (CCC) office announced the 2023-24 CCC Women's Basketball Coaches' Preseason Poll on Wednesday morning, as the Corban University Women's Basketball team was picked to finish one spot higher than their final standing last season with a sixth-place finish on tab for this upcoming year.

"As always, the CCC is going to be a tough matchup every night," Warriors' head coach Bill Pilgeram stated when asked to comment on the poll results. "We are ready for the challenge and excited to get some games played as we prepare to be right in the mix for conference play."
To no surprise, defending CCC co-champions of the regular season, Eastern Oregon University and Lewis-Clark State College, each finished within a single vote of each other at the top of this year's poll, with the Mountaineers (136) picked to win the conference despite LC State (135) holding more first place votes, 6 to 5.
Southern Oregon University (123) received the last remaining first-place vote of the poll to sit firmly in third place, followed by Oregon Tech and Bushnell University who round out the top five with 99 and 96 votes, respectively.
The Warriors (80) are the only program in the poll to rise in the rankings when compared to their finish in the 2022-23 season, as they jumped The College of Idaho (74) to give themselves a fighting chance in being considered for a top five selection. Northwest University (57) rounds out the eight teams that are considered to be the preseason selections to eventually reach the 2023-24 CCC Tournament next February.
The last four remaining teams in the preseason poll are represented by The Evergreen State College (41) in ninth, Multnomah University (37) and Walla Walla University (37) who each tied for tenth, and conclude with Warner Pacific University (17) in twelfth overall.
